1987 Cadillac Allante vs. 2005 Ford Escape
To start off, 2005 Ford Escape is newer by 18 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1987 Cadillac Allante.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1987 Cadillac Allante would be higher. At 4,087 cc (8 cylinders), 1987 Cadillac Allante is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2005 Ford Escape (201 HP) has 33 more horse power than 1987 Cadillac Allante. (168 HP) In normal driving conditions, 2005 Ford Escape should accelerate faster than 1987 Cadillac Allante.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1987 Cadillac Allante weights approximately 6 kg more than 2005 Ford Escape.
Because 2005 Ford Escape is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 1987 Cadillac Allante.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2005 Ford Escape will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control.
Compare all specifications:
1987 Cadillac Allante | 2005 Ford Escape | |
Make | Cadillac | Ford |
Model | Allante | Escape |
Year Released | 1987 | 2005 |
Body Type | Convertible | SUV |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 4087 cc | 2961 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 8 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| V |
Horse Power | 168 HP | 201 HP |
Engine Bore Size | 88 mm | 89.1 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 84 mm | 80 mm |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Front | 4WD |
Number of Seats | 2 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1590 kg | 1584 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4550 mm | 4450 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1880 mm | 1790 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1330 mm | 1780 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2530 mm | 2630 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 75 L | 62 L |
